i raced the c63 in Belgium up to 160 and stuck with it but i was behind so had the slipstream. from inside the car the merc feels like it is much faster in a straight line. on twistys the rs4 wins

also had a go against a a45 and then the rs4 struggles on the twistys to keep pace and there isnt much in it on the straight between the 2.
